The street in brief

Sales on Douglas Avenue are mostly terraced houses. The median sale price is £105,000, about 42% below the typical HD3 sale. Recent sales are too thin to call a trend for the street itself; HD3 prices as a whole have been rising. HM Land Registry records 13 sales across 11 homes since 2001 — homes here come up rarely.

Douglas Avenue's £105,000 median sits about 42% below HD3's £182,000.

Street and HD3 figures are medians of HM Land Registry sales; the England figures are the UK House Price Index mix-adjusted average — a different basis, so compare direction rather than levels between the two.

Sales marked non-standardare Land Registry “additional price paid” entries — bulk purchases, repossessions, right-to-buy and similar transfers. They're listed for completeness but excluded from every median and comparison figure on this page.
